Session Description:
The first decades of the 21st century have proved an exciting time for planetary science missions. With New Horizons, objects of the Kuiper Belt are finally being explored, while other missions have revealed previously unknown surfaces of planets, moons, asteroids and comets ranging from Titan to Mercury, and from Ceres to Comet 67P. The next several decades promise to be as dramatic, with first explorations of many more asteroids, comets and moons, a return to the ice giants Uranus and Neptune, and in situ exploration of surfaces and sub-surfaces. The landscape of planetary missions has also changed dramatically, as new countries have begun to send missions to deep space destinations, while NASA has revitalized its mission portfolio with competed mission of all sizes, from CubeSats to New Frontiers missions. This session solicits innovative mission and payload concepts of all sizes, types, and from all countries and institutions.
